| (Chinese: 罗布泊;pinyin: luóbùpō): Lop Nur once was the second largest inland lake in China and an important station on the Silk Road. In Uygur, 'Lop' means a place having a vast expanse of water. In Mongolian, 'Nur' refers to a lake. 'Lop' and 'Nur' together means a vast lake. However, it dried up in 1972 because over deforestation and environmental deterioration caused by human activity in the area. Sandstorms and high temperatures have changed Lop Nur into the 'Sea of Death' and nowadays, it is a paradise for travelers who love adventure. |
